Village vs. The Lake: Understanding the Layout for Visitors
For first-time visitors, it’s crucial to understand that the commercial hub of Lake Louise Village-centred around Samson Mall-is situated 4 kilometres from the famous lakeshore. The village provides essential amenities, including a grocery store, boutique shops, and a helpful visitor centre. The iconic Fairmont Chateau Lake Louise enjoys a premium location directly on the shores of the lake itself. Convenient shuttles and scenic walking paths connect the two areas, ensuring seamless access.
A Year-Round Destination: What to Expect in Each Season
Lake Louise offers a unique and elegant experience throughout the year, with each season revealing a different facet of its beauty. Planning your luxurious trip is simple when you know what to expect:
- Summer (June – September): Witness the lake in its most famous state-a brilliant turquoise jewel. This is the prime season for hiking pristine trails and canoeing across the calm, glacier-fed waters.
- Autumn (September – October): Experience the magic of the “Larch Valley,” where golden trees create a stunning contrast against the mountain peaks. Enjoy the scenery with fewer crowds.
- Winter (November – April): The landscape transforms into a winter wonderland. The frozen lake becomes a majestic skating rink, and the area hosts the spectacular Ice Magic Festival. Snowshoeing and cross-country skiing are popular.
- Spring (May – June): Watch as the landscape awakens. The ice on the lake begins to thaw, revealing its emerging colour, and it’s an excellent time for wildlife sightings as animals become more active.

The Challenges of Self-Driving: Parking, Traffic, and Stress
While driving yourself offers a sense of freedom, it comes with significant challenges. Parking at the Lake Louise shoreline is extremely limited and often full before sunrise, even on weekdays. This forces most visitors into the mandatory Parks Canada shuttle system, requiring a reservation and a trip from a remote Park & Ride lot. Navigating mountain roads, potential wildlife encounters, and paying for both a park pass and parking in C$ can add unnecessary stress to what should be a spectacular day.
Public Transit and Shuttles: A Practical Overview
Public options like Roam Transit and the Parks Canada shuttle provide a functional way to reach the lake. They eliminate the parking issue but introduce new constraints. These services run on fixed schedules, limiting your flexibility to explore at your own pace. Buses can be crowded, especially during peak season, turning a scenic journey into a logistical shuffle rather than a comfortable and premium experience.

Indulgent Dining: Afternoon Tea and Gourmet Meals
For a classic and sophisticated treat, reserve a spot for the traditional Afternoon Tea at the Fairmont, a timeless experience with an unparalleled view. The culinary excellence extends throughout the area, with several fine dining options available to complete your luxury day trip. Consider these esteemed choices:
- Walliser Stube: Located in the Fairmont, this intimate restaurant offers an authentic European alpine menu, famous for its traditional Swiss fondue.
- Post Hotel Dining Room: A celebrated Relais & Châteaux property known for its award-winning wine cellar and refined Canadian menu.
Reservations are essential, particularly during peak season. For a more casual yet delightful option, enjoy a gourmet coffee and pastry in the charming lake louise village.
Elevated Outdoor Activities: Canoeing and Gondola Rides
Experience the lake’s serenity by renting a signature red canoe. Gliding across the vibrant turquoise water is a peaceful and exclusive activity that provides a unique perspective of the surrounding peaks. For unparalleled panoramic views, the Lake Louise Gondola offers a stunning ascent with one of the highest chances of grizzly bear sightings in the park. Discerning hikers will appreciate the journey to the Plain of Six Glaciers Teahouse, a rewarding trek that culminates in a historic and charming alpine rest stop.

Do I need a Parks Canada Pass to visit Lake Louise?
Yes, a valid Parks Canada Discovery Pass is mandatory for any vehicle stopping within Banff National Park, which includes Lake Louise. These passes can be purchased online ahead of your trip or at the park entry gates.
